Zipzopdippidybopbop  [作者] 2024 年 2 月 11 日 上午 7:00 
NOTE: Updated to the latest version (1.36).

Also removed the drill decay modifier for professional armies - armies with high drill and high professional effectively never decay (or decay ridiculously slowly). As such, this should keep drill necessary even for professional armies late game to ensure additional combat effectiveness (on top of their professional tier buffs).

Zipzopdippidybopbop  [作者] 2023 年 5 月 21 日 下午 2:06 
Ok, updated now.

Update 1;

- Removed Military Tactics boost at 100% Professionalism
- Tweaked Army Upkeep at Professional Tiers to be harsher (to compensate for the high boosts). New values are as follows;

20% Professionalism = 10% Upkeep Increase to Armies
40% Professionalism = 25% Upkeep Increase to Armies
60% Professionalism = 50% Upkeep Increase to Armies
80% Professionalism = 75% Upkeep Increase to Armies
100% Professionalism = 100% Upkeep Increase to Armies

- Nerfed Drill Decay at Max Professionalism; units will now no longer maintain max Drill ad infinitum!
